-
id_ccDescrição: Relacionado com o campo id da tabela Carteira de cobrança.
Dados técnicos:- Tipo de campo: Campo de busca avançada
- Campo obrigatório: Sim
- Valores disponíveis:
-
id_filialDescrição: Relacionado com o campo id da tabela Filial.
Dados técnicos:- Tipo de campo: Campo de busca avançada
- Campo obrigatório: Não
- Valores disponíveis:
-
id_remessaDescrição: Relacionado com o campo id da tabela Arquivos de remessa.
Dados técnicos:- Tipo de campo: Campo de busca avançada
- Campo obrigatório: Não
- Valores disponíveis:
-
id_clienteDescrição: Relacionado com o campo id da tabela Cliente.
Dados técnicos:- Tipo de campo: Campo de busca avançada
- Campo obrigatório: Não
- Valores disponíveis:
-
tipo_clienteDescrição: Relacionado com o campo id da tabela Tipo de cliente.
Dados técnicos:- Tipo de campo: Campo de busca avançada
- Campo obrigatório: Não
- Valores disponíveis:
-
id_tipo_contratoDescrição: Relacionado com o campo id da tabela Tipo de cobrança contrato.
Dados técnicos:- Tipo de campo: Campo de busca avançada
- Campo obrigatório: Não
- Valores disponíveis:
-
id_cidadeDescrição: Relacionado com o campo id da tabela Cidade.
Dados técnicos:- Tipo de campo: Campo de busca avançada
- Campo obrigatório: Não
- Valores disponíveis:
-
bairroDados técnicos:
- Tipo de campo: Campo de texto
- Campo obrigatório: Não
- Quant. máx. de caracteres: 100
-
id_condominioDescrição: Relacionado com o campo id da tabela Condomínio.
Dados técnicos:- Tipo de campo: Campo de busca avançada
- Campo obrigatório: Não
- Valores disponíveis:
-
condominio_blocoDados técnicos:
- Tipo de campo: Campo de texto
- Campo obrigatório: Não
- Quant. máx. de caracteres: 100
-
condominio_apartamentoDados técnicos:
- Tipo de campo: Campo de texto
- Campo obrigatório: Não
- Quant. máx. de caracteres: 10
-
siDados técnicos:
- Tipo de campo: Campo de texto
- Campo obrigatório: Não
- Quant. máx. de caracteres: 15
- Máscara: Número inteiro
-
sfDados técnicos:
- Tipo de campo: Campo de texto
- Campo obrigatório: Não
- Quant. máx. de caracteres: 15
- Máscara: Número inteiro
-
cre_inicialDados técnicos:
- Tipo de campo: Campo de texto
- Campo obrigatório: Não
- Quant. máx. de caracteres: 15
- Máscara: Número inteiro
-
cre_finalDados técnicos:
- Tipo de campo: Campo de texto
- Campo obrigatório: Não
- Quant. máx. de caracteres: 15
- Máscara: Número inteiro
-
data_eiDados técnicos:
- Tipo de campo: Campo de texto
- Campo obrigatório: Não
- Quant. máx. de caracteres: 10
- Máscara: Calendário - 99/99/9999
- Calendário: Sim
-
data_efDados técnicos:
- Tipo de campo: Campo de texto
- Campo obrigatório: Não
- Quant. máx. de caracteres: 10
- Máscara: Calendário - 99/99/9999
- Calendário: Sim
-
data_viDados técnicos:
- Tipo de campo: Campo de texto
- Campo obrigatório: Não
- Quant. máx. de caracteres: 10
- Máscara: Calendário - 99/99/9999
- Calendário: Sim
-
data_vfDados técnicos:
- Tipo de campo: Campo de texto
- Campo obrigatório: Não
- Quant. máx. de caracteres: 10
- Máscara: Calendário - 99/99/9999
- Calendário: Sim
-
id_cli_iniDados técnicos:
- Tipo de campo: Campo de texto
- Campo obrigatório: Não
- Quant. máx. de caracteres: 9
- Máscara: Número inteiro
-
id_cli_finDados técnicos:
- Tipo de campo: Campo de texto
- Campo obrigatório: Não
- Quant. máx. de caracteres: 9
- Máscara: Número inteiro
-
tipo_cobrancaDados técnicos:
- Tipo de campo: Botão de seleção
- Campo obrigatório: Não
- Valor Padrão: Impresso
- Valores disponíveis:
I = Impresso
E = E-mail
T = Todos
-
statusDados técnicos:
- Tipo de campo: Botão de seleção
- Campo obrigatório: Não
- Valor Padrão: Abertos
- Valores disponíveis:
A = Abertos
T = Todos
-
impressoDados técnicos:
- Tipo de campo: Botão de seleção
- Campo obrigatório: Não
- Valor Padrão: Todos
- Valores disponíveis:
S = Sim
N = Não
T = Todos
-
ordenacaoDados técnicos:
- Tipo de campo: Botão de seleção
- Campo obrigatório: Sim
- Valor Padrão: Padrão(por endereço)
- Valores disponíveis:
P = Padrão(por endereço)
A = Alfabética(Razão)
V = Por vencimento
B = Por bairro
I = ID do cliente
CBE = Cidade/Bairro/Endereço
BLC = Condomínio/Bloco/Apartamento
AP = Apartamento
-
jurosDados técnicos:
- Tipo de campo: Botão de seleção
- Campo obrigatório: Não
- Valor Padrão: Sim
- Valores disponíveis:
S = Sim
N = Não
-
multaDados técnicos:
- Tipo de campo: Botão de seleção
- Campo obrigatório: Não
- Valor Padrão: Sim
- Valores disponíveis:
S = Sim
N = Não
-
atualizar_vencimentoDados técnicos:
- Tipo de campo: Caixa de seleção
- Campo obrigatório: Não
- Valor Padrão: S
-
enviar_por_emailDados técnicos:
- Tipo de campo: Botão de seleção
- Campo obrigatório: Não
- Valor Padrão: Somente Boleto
- Valores disponíveis:
3 = Somente Boleto
2 = Somente Nota FIscal
1 = Nota Fiscal + Boleto
-
diasDados técnicos:
- Tipo de campo: Campo de texto
- Campo obrigatório: Não
- Quant. máx. de caracteres: 15
- Máscara: Número inteiro
- Valor Padrão: 3
-
Inserir
require(__DIR__ . DIRECTORY_SEPARATOR . 'WebserviceClient.php'); $host = 'https://SEU_DOMINIO/webservice/v1'; $token = '6:4dacdb8e47193e8cbbabe508c3c59b4547e463817b1d9b9a1d20ab4812fe1a62';//token gerado no cadastro do usuario (verificar permissões) $selfSigned = true; //true para certificado auto assinado $api = new IXCsoft\WebserviceClient($host, $token, $selfSigned); $dados = array( 'id_cc' => '', 'id_filial' => '', 'id_remessa' => '', 'id_cliente' => '', 'tipo_cliente' => '', 'id_tipo_contrato' => '', 'id_cidade' => '', 'bairro' => '', 'id_condominio' => '', 'condominio_bloco' => '', 'condominio_apartamento' => '', 'si' => '', 'sf' => '', 'cre_inicial' => '', 'cre_final' => '', 'data_ei' => '', 'data_ef' => '', 'data_vi' => '', 'data_vf' => '', 'id_cli_ini' => '', 'id_cli_fin' => '', 'tipo_cobranca' => 'I', 'status' => 'A', 'impresso' => 'T', 'ordenacao' => 'P', 'juros' => 'S', 'multa' => 'S', 'atualizar_vencimento' => 'S', 'enviar_por_email' => '3', 'dias' => '3' ); $api->post('rfn_boletos', $dados); $retorno = $api->getRespostaConteudo(false);// false para json | true para array
-
Editar
require(__DIR__ . DIRECTORY_SEPARATOR . 'WebserviceClient.php'); $host = 'https://SEU_DOMINIO/webservice/v1'; $token = '6:4dacdb8e47193e8cbbabe508c3c59b4547e463817b1d9b9a1d20ab4812fe1a62';//token gerado no cadastro do usuario (verificar permissões) $selfSigned = true; //true para certificado auto assinado $api = new IXCsoft\WebserviceClient($host, $token, $selfSigned); $dados = array( 'id_cc' => '', 'id_filial' => '', 'id_remessa' => '', 'id_cliente' => '', 'tipo_cliente' => '', 'id_tipo_contrato' => '', 'id_cidade' => '', 'bairro' => '', 'id_condominio' => '', 'condominio_bloco' => '', 'condominio_apartamento' => '', 'si' => '', 'sf' => '', 'cre_inicial' => '', 'cre_final' => '', 'data_ei' => '', 'data_ef' => '', 'data_vi' => '', 'data_vf' => '', 'id_cli_ini' => '', 'id_cli_fin' => '', 'tipo_cobranca' => 'I', 'status' => 'A', 'impresso' => 'T', 'ordenacao' => 'P', 'juros' => 'S', 'multa' => 'S', 'atualizar_vencimento' => 'S', 'enviar_por_email' => '3', 'dias' => '3' ); $registro = '1';//registro a ser editado $api->put('rfn_boletos', $dados, $registro); $retorno = $api->getRespostaConteudo(false);// false para json | true para array
-
Deletar
require(__DIR__ . DIRECTORY_SEPARATOR . 'WebserviceClient.php'); $host = 'https://SEU_DOMINIO/webservice/v1'; $token = '6:4dacdb8e47193e8cbbabe508c3c59b4547e463817b1d9b9a1d20ab4812fe1a62';//token gerado no cadastro do usuario (verificar permissões) $selfSigned = true; //true para certificado auto assinado $api = new IXCsoft\WebserviceClient($host, $token, $selfSigned); $registro = '1';//registro a ser deletado $api->delete('rfn_boletos', $registro); $retorno = $api->getRespostaConteudo(false);// false para json | true para array
-
Listar
require(__DIR__ . DIRECTORY_SEPARATOR . 'WebserviceClient.php'); $host = 'https://SEU_DOMINIO/webservice/v1'; $token = '6:4dacdb8e47193e8cbbabe508c3c59b4547e463817b1d9b9a1d20ab4812fe1a62';//token gerado no cadastro do usuario (verificar permissões) $selfSigned = true; //true para certificado auto assinado $api = new IXCsoft\WebserviceClient($host, $token, $selfSigned); $params = array( 'qtype' => 'rfn_boletos.id',//campo de filtro 'query' => '1',//valor para consultar 'oper' => '=',//operador da consulta 'page' => '1',//página a ser mostrada 'rp' => '20',//quantidade de registros por página 'sortname' => 'rfn_boletos.id',//campo para ordenar a consulta 'sortorder' => 'desc'//ordenação (asc= crescente | desc=decrescente) ); $api->get('rfn_boletos', $params); $retorno = $api->getRespostaConteudo(false);// false para json | true para array